The industrial pin mill (also known as a universal mill, turbo mill, and impact mill) is a one pass grinding equipment ideal for achieving the micronization of bulk materials and powdered products.Common applications involve the fine grinding of sugar, salt, sodium bicarb, etc.

Get PriceCompartments (filled with grinding media) are divided by a double diaphragm with flow control to utilize maximum mill length for effective grinding. Grinding media contain balls of different sizes in designed proportions with large sizes in feed end and small sizes in discharge end. About 27 to 35 % volume of mill is filled with grinding media.

Get PriceThe IsaMill is an energy-efficient mineral industry grinding mill that was jointly developed in the 1990s by Mount Isa Mines Limited ("MIM", a subsidiary of MIM Holdings Limited and now part of the Glencore Xstrata group of companies) and Netzsch Feinmahltechnik ("Netzsch"), a German manufacturer of bead mills. Get PriceGrinding media fill up about one third of a mill. The grinding media load can be readily measured. The grinding media load can be determined from the mill diameter and the distance between the top of the load and the top of the mill.
